brielo, that's a personal mod I created for myself, since where I live the grass is more yellowish during the winter. I'd be glad to give it to you, but I think it needs some fixing as I've been having some issues with it in Newcrest.
In reference to earlier posts I hadn't seen before mine got merged (very glad some other people noticed this), yes, there were some plant objects that didn't change with the seasons before the patch messed things up. I have experience modding them, and I can tell you that it is a completely separate issue from this. Many of the objects that previously didn't change with the seasons have a non-plant component to them. Modding them so they will change for the seasons causes the non-plant component to change to a browner color during the winter, too. Sometimes it isn't a big deal. In fact, I have plenty of them modded in my game even with this problem. So they are more complicated than other objects. (However, EA has shown they can do it, just look at the rock formations in the background of the following image, the grass on them changes with the seasons... Or it did. The September patch broke them, too!)
(Another example, which I believe was posted before, was of a hedge with roses that didn't change with the seasons even before the patch. The reason for that is because it's technically a fence. In order for the coding for the plants to change for the seasons to work, the object has to be coded as a plant.)
